質問

友達、

現在Ktemmerを使用して、私のアプリケーションでステミング操作を実行するために私はSolrで開発します。Ktemmerを使用している場合は、Protwords.txt

を取り上げていません。
<analyzer type="query">
    <tokenizer class="solr.StandardTokenizerFactory"/>
    <filter class="solr.SynonymFilterFactory" synonyms="synonyms.txt" ignoreCase="true" expand="true"/>
    <filter class="solr.StopFilterFactory"
            ignoreCase="true"
            words="stopwords.txt"
            enablePositionIncrements="true"
            />
    <filter class="solr.LowerCaseFilterFactory"/>
<filter class="solr.EnglishPossessiveFilterFactory"/>
    <filter class="solr.KStemFilterFactory" protected="protwords.txt"/>

  </analyzer>
.

プロトワードの単語を保護されているとしていません。これはkstemが機能するのですか?

役に立ちましたか?

解決

ソースコードをチェックしましたが、Implementation.btwが表示されませんでした。Solr 3.6のソースコードをチェックしました。

snowballporterfilterfactory kstemfilterfactory

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top